ZEISS Semiconductor Manufacturing Technology Enabling smaller, more powerful and more energy-efficient microchips
Working where tomorrow is created.
Around 80 per cent of all microchips worldwide are manufactured using ZEISS technologies. As the heart of every electronically controlled system, they have become an indispensable part of our everyday lives – whether in smartphones, smart homes or smart factories. ZEISS is a technology leader in the field of semiconductor manufacturing equipment. The focus is on the continuous development and stabilisation of cleaning and coating processes for high-precision optical components.
Your Role In this role, you take ownership for new product introductions and quality topics and apply established structured problem-solving methods to secure stable processes.
Together with Manufacturing and R&D, you introduce innovative processes along the value stream and continuously enhance existing workflows.
A particular focus of your work is the supervision and optimization of cleaning processes for high‑precision optical components, ensuring highest cleanliness and quality requirements are met.
You also monitor and optimize coating processes for optical components to improve process stability, throughput and product quality.
You proactively drive technology changes and ensure that targets regarding timing, cost and quality are achieved.
Experimental plans are defined and executed by you, including the selection of suitable parameters, systematic evaluation of the results and transparent documentation.
By involving colleagues from interfacing departments, you gain their commitment for your projects and foster effective cross‑functional collaboration.
Your Profile You hold a successfully completed university degree in a natural or engineering science such as Chemistry, Process Engineering, Materials Science or a comparable field.
You have several years of relevant experience in production environments, ideally in the optical industry or similarly demanding high‑tech manufacturing.
Proven expertise in process optimization in a manufacturing context is part of your background, and you confidently apply structured problem‑solving methods (for example PDCA, 8D).You are particularly experienced in cleaning processes for high‑precision optical components as well as in precision cleaning of sensitive parts and ideally bring hands‑on experience with cleanroom technology, vacuum technology and coating technology.
A high level of initiative, strong analytical skills and excellent communication capabilities characterize you and enable you to convince and align different stakeholders.
You are fluent in German and have very good command of English, both written and spoken, allowing you to operate safely in an international environment.
